The Utah Talons, the new team in the Athletes Unlimited Softball League, will play their first home game in Salt Lake City at the Dumke Family Softball Stadium on Tuesday. Head coach Cindy Ball-Malone expressed excitement about her new role. Players like catcher Sharlize Palacios and pitcher Montana Fouts participated in preseason media availability ahead of the game. The Talons aim to elevate the sport of softball in Utah while seeking further success in the league.
